The Ledgerline audit-log viewer exposes a read-only REST surface, so don't worry — nothing here can mutate records. You can filter events by actor, resource, or time window, and pagination is cursor-based with a hard cap of 500 rows per page. All requests are themselves logged, which is pleasantly meta. To poke at the staging instance, authenticate with the internal reviewer key below.

gateway credential: kto3_qfe

Runbook: Mailhollow bounce processor

Welcome aboard. The bounce processor drains the suppression queue every five minutes; hard bounces are suppressed immediately, soft bounces after three occurrences within seven days. If the queue depth alarm fires, check the parser logs first — malformed DSNs are the usual culprit. The thresholds and intervals come from the settings below.

deployment values, fahap-hahaf:
[casdor]
port = 9200
region = south-2
host = casdor.qirvanworks.corp
timeout_ms = 3000
retries = 4

## 2.14.0 — ORM refactor + key rotation

Legacy Quillbase ORM layer replaced with the new Ferrule mapper. All session models migrated; raw SQL shims removed from the billing path. Rollback: redeploy 2.13.8, no schema changes shipped. Watch for slow-query alerts on the tenants table for the first hour — connection pooling defaults changed.

As part of this release we rotated the deploy credentials for the Ferrule pipeline. Old key is revoked as of this build. The new deploy key is:

rollout seal: bky9_USgf6CpEz